Key Functions of the DOH

The Department of Health (DOH) is the principal health agency in the Philippines, responsible for ensuring access to basic public health services. It formulates policies, plans, and standards for health programs and services nationwide.

Key functions of the DOH include disease prevention and control, health promotion, and regulation of health facilities and services. The DOH also conducts health research, manages health emergencies, and oversees the implementation of national health programs.

DOH Organizational Structure

The Department of Health (DOH) is the primary government agency responsible for ensuring public health and wellbeing. Its organizational structure is designed to streamline health services across national and local levels.

  • Central Office - Oversees policy development, coordination, and regulatory functions for health programs nationwide.
  • Regional Health Offices - Implement national health policies and supervise local health services within specific geographic areas.
  • Attached Agencies - Specialized units provide focused services such as disease control, health research, and medical regulation.

Services Offered by the DOH

The Department of Health (DOH) provides essential health services aimed at improving public health nationwide. These services ensure accessibility, quality, and comprehensive care for all citizens.

  • Health Promotion and Education - Implements programs to raise awareness on disease prevention and healthy lifestyles.
  • Disease Control and Prevention - Manages vaccination drives and monitoring of infectious disease outbreaks.
  • Healthcare Service Delivery - Operates public hospitals and clinics to provide medical treatment and emergency care.
  • Regulation and Licensing - Oversees the accreditation of health facilities and the licensing of healthcare professionals.
  • Nutrition and Maternal Health - Provides nutritional support and maternal health services to reduce infant and maternal mortality rates.

The DOH continues to expand and enhance its services to meet the evolving health needs of the population.
